She burst into tears the first time she tried on pelvic floor support wear that was supposed to help her — instead, it fell off and left her in more pain.

On this episode of Femtech At Work, a women's health innovation podcast, Rosie Dumbrell, Founder of Everform Therapywear and a pelvic-health-trained physiotherapist, shares how that moment set her on a five-year journey to build something better. If you're building something in femtech, watch closely — Rosie's story is a real lesson in solving a problem nobody else wanted to touch. And her honesty about what it's cost her, personally, is the kind of thing that sticks with you long after you've stopped listening.
